Requirements

  • Doctorate degree in allopathic or osteopathic medicine from an accredited medical school.
  • Board certification in a specialty recognized by ABMS or AOA-BOS, preferably primary care.
  • Current and unrestricted medical license in the practicing state.
  • Valid National Provider Identifier (NPI) and DEA registration for controlled substances.

Physicians (MD/DO) are in high demand across healthcare settings, with growing interest in positions that offer sustainable schedules and reduced administrative burden.

Nationally, Hospice and Palliative Medicine professionals earn a median annual salary of approximately $260k, with the typical range spanning $200k to $340k depending on experience, location, and practice setting.
